Estimated Cost Range
$1,200 - $2,800 (smaller scope)
$3,500 - $7,000 (larger scope)
| Project Type | Typical Range |
|---|---|
| Basic slab leveling | $1,200 - $2,800 |
| Full foundation lift | $4,000 - $7,000 |
| Pier and beam leveling | $3,500 - $5,500 |
| Concrete slab repair | $1,500 - $3,000 |
| Crack sealing and stabilization | $1,200 - $2,800 |
| Underpinning | $5,000 - $12,000 |
Factors Affecting Cost
Home foundation leveling in Pooler, GA, involves adjusting and stabilizing a property's foundation to address settling or unevenness. This process is essential for maintaining the structural integrity of homes and preventing further issues. Understanding the typical scope and materials used can help homeowners make informed decisions about foundation repairs.
- Materials: Commonly involves steel piers, concrete piers, or mudjacking foam, selected based on soil conditions and foundation type.
- Size and Scope: Projects range from small adjustments under specific areas to comprehensive leveling for entire foundations.
- Labor Complexity: Varies depending on foundation type, property size, and accessibility, often requiring specialized equipment and techniques.
- Permitting: Local regulations in Pooler, GA, may require permits for foundation work, particularly for larger or structural modifications.
- Additional Services: May include crack repair, drainage improvements, or soil stabilization to support long-term foundation stability.
